Output 33f529d3c706a9a4326bf17c13d95259ab7763b1a37e43f7c2dd289810718069:159

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1bdcd21a8a7a840e43783a78581f32d3bcac64ed7021000641b69c159189efb5
address
bc1pr0wdyx5202zqusmc8fu9s8ej6w72ce8dwqssqpjpk6wptyvfa76stfjm9n
transaction
33f529d3c706a9a4326bf17c13d95259ab7763b1a37e43f7c2dd289810718069